WebKorea supplier of Riflescope, Dot sight, Bow sight. SU OPTICS, a Korean company that specializes in rifles, was established in 2008 with 20 years of technical background. SU OPTICS develops and produces high-quality rifle scopes with creative technology and is currently leading the rifle scope market ...
